Question, I want to play a Noble with Starship Designer, but I have to have Mechanics as a trained skill.  I thought I could take Skill Training to make it trained, but it says that I have to choose a class skill to be trained in.  Do I have to take a level of a different class to take it as a trained skill?

Idej

There is the engineer talent in Starships of the Galaxy and if you have Knowledge(Technology) then Mechanics becomes a trained skill.

The Great Triangle

Quote from: Myrleena on February 08, 2009, 11:47:51 PM
Question, I want to play a Noble with Starship Designer, but I have to have Mechanics as a trained skill.  I thought I could take Skill Training to make it trained, but it says that I have to choose a class skill to be trained in.  Do I have to take a level of a different class to take it as a trained skill?

You will, although two levels is arguably more efficient.  (since it gives you the feat)  You can also, of course, take the educated talent and the engineer talent.  (which grants the benefit of being able to build starships 25% faster)

Some good choices include the scoundrel class to get a bonus to reflex defense, point blank shot, and the spacehound talent (for operating in zero G), the scout class to get shake it off and the evasion talent, or the soldier class to get more weapon proficiencies and a weapon specialization.

Finely tuned isn't actually a template, but a function of having the tech specialist feat.  (He modified his lightsaber to have a +1 attack bonus.)  His attack bonus is calculated as +13 base attack bonus, +4 strength, +1 self made lightsaber, +1 finely tuned lightsaber.  Meanwhile, his damage is +7 for level, plus 4 for strength.

I wouldn't mind you PMing your character concept.  :)

As for slavery, the Sith Empire and the Hutts endorse slavery strongly, while the Fel Empire and the Mandalorians legalize slavery but makes slave transportation illegal, and the Alliance strongly opposes slavery.  The Imperial knights stop slave smuggling when they can, but assign slaves thus acquired as indentured servants to the sector moff.  (often on terms under which they will see freedom within their lifetime)  Meanwhile, the New Jedi Order strongly opposes slavery in alliance space, but considers slavery in areas where it is illegal to be an unpleasant fact of life in the galaxy.  (though they take pains to free force sensitive slaves when they can, lest they turn to the dark side)

As for how much slaves try to escape, most everyone but the Mandalorians has slave flight to an extremely low level.  The Sith use a combination of intimidation and mind control to keep their slaves under control, the Hutts use collars designed either to strangle, decapitate, or electrocute fleeing slaves, and the Fel empire offers slaves the chance to earn their freedom.  The Mandalorains, meanwhile, tend to simply accept that slaves in conquered provinces will run, and consider any slave with the strength to escape his master to be a free man.  (who can then become a Mandalorian by pledging military service to the Mandalore.)  Slave owners in Mandalorian space, of course, go to great lengths to restrain their slaves, but Hutt slave collars are illegal in Mandalorian territory, because their use risks killing perfectly good warriors.
